CABBAGE BEEF SOUP



Cabbage Beef Soup image

Very yummy soup that has always been a hit! Main ingredients include ground beef, cabbage, tomato sauce, kidney beans and onion. I promise you won't regret making it!

Time 8h20m

Yield 10

Number Of Ingredients 11

2 tablespoons vegetable oil
1 pound ground beef
½ large onion, chopped
5 cups chopped cabbage
2 (16 ounce) cans red kidney beans, drained
2 cups water
24 ounces tomato sauce
4 beef bouillon cubes
1 ½ teaspoons ground cumin
1 teaspoon salt
1 teaspoon pepper

Steps:

  • Heat oil in a large stockpot over medium high heat. Add ground beef and onion, and cook until beef is well browned and crumbled. Drain fat, and transfer beef to a slow cooker. Add cabbage, kidney beans, water, tomato sauce, bouillon, cumin, salt, and pepper. Stir to dissolve bouillon, and cover.
  • Cook on high setting for 4 hours, or on low setting for 6 to 8 hours. Stir occasionally. Enjoy!

BEEF AND CABBAGE SOUP A LA SHONEYS



Beef and Cabbage Soup a La Shoneys image

i tried to copy this cause we have no shoneys up here and i really like this soup

Time 1h

Yield 10 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 12

1 lb ground beef
1/2 head cabbage
2 celery ribs
1 bell pepper
1 onion
1 (16 ounce) can kidney beans
1 (28 ounce) can tomatoes
4 beef bouillon cubes
2 garlic cloves
2 teaspoons Worcestershire sauce
2 cups water
1 teaspoon pepper

Steps:

  • Dice the vegetables.
  • Brown the ground beef.
  • Drain.
  • Add onion, celery, bell pepper and garlic.
  • Cook until wilted.
  • Add the diced cabbage.
  • Add tomatoes juice and all.
  • Add Worcestershire sauce.
  • Add pepper.
  • Add 2 cups water.
  • add boullion cubes
  • Add drained beans.
  • Cook 30 minutes.

CABBAGE AND BEEF SOUP



Cabbage and Beef Soup image

When I was a little girl, I helped my parents work the fields of their small farm. Lunchtime was always a treat when Mother picked fresh vegetables from the garden and simmered them in her big soup pot. We loved making this delicious recipe. -Ethel Ledbetter, Canton, North Carolina

Time 1h20m

Yield 12 servings (3 quarts).

Number Of Ingredients 11

1 pound lean ground beef (90% lean)
1/2 teaspoon garlic salt
1/4 teaspoon garlic powder
1/4 teaspoon pepper
2 celery ribs, chopped
1 can (16 ounces) kidney beans, rinsed and drained
1/2 medium head cabbage, chopped
1 can (28 ounces) diced tomatoes, undrained
3-1/2 cups water
4 teaspoons beef bouillon granules
Minced fresh parsley

Steps:

  • In a Dutch oven, cook beef over medium heat until no longer pink, breaking it into crumbles; drain. Stir in the remaining ingredients except parsley. , Bring to a boil. Reduce heat; cover and simmer for 1 hour. Garnish with parsley.

SHONEY'S BEAN AND BEEF CABBAGE SOUP



Shoney's Bean and Beef Cabbage Soup image

This is a hearty soup is full of flavor! Along with the red beans, the mixture of ground meat and sausage gives this soup a unique flavor. Time 5h

Number Of Ingredients 14

1 bag(s) red kidney beans, soaked and drained
1 lb ground beef, browned and drained
1/2 lb ground sausage, browned and drained
1 medium onion, chopped
1 medium bell pepper, chopped
3 stalk(s) celery, chopped
3 clove garlic, chopped
1 medium cabbage, chopped
28 oz can of chopped tomatoes
10 oz Rotel tomatoes
8 oz tomato sauce
4 oz tomato paste
salt and pepper, to taste
seasonings of choice (basil, oregano, etc)

Steps:

  • 1. Rinse beans and pick out any broken or bad beans. Soak the beans for two hours and drain.
  • 2. Cook the beans until almost done according to the package.
  • 3. Brown the ground beef and sausage and drain.
  • 4. Add the onion, bell pepper, celery, and garlic and cook about 10 minutes.
  • 5. Add this and your cans of tomatoes to the bean pot.
  • 6. Season to your personal taste.
  • 7. Cook about an hour longer. When beans are tender, mash some of the beans along the sides of the pot to get a thicker soup.
  • 8. Add the chopped cabbage and simmer twenty more minutes. Serve warm with fresh toasted homemade croutons!
